| // This header declares classes for the infeed manager and the infeed |
| // buffer that are used by the GPU runtime to transfer buffers into an |
| // executing GPU computation, e.g., to feed data into a while loop. |
| |
| #ifndef TENSORFLOW_COMPILER_XLA_SERVICE_GPU_INFEED_MANAGER_H_ |
| #define TENSORFLOW_COMPILER_XLA_SERVICE_GPU_INFEED_MANAGER_H_ |
| |
| #include "absl/base/thread_annotations.h" |
| #include "tensorflow/compiler/xla/literal.h" |
| #include "tensorflow/compiler/xla/service/gpu/xfeed_queue.h" |
| #include "tensorflow/compiler/xla/shape_tree.h" |
| #include "tensorflow/compiler/xla/types.h" |
| #include "tensorflow/core/platform/stream_executor_no_cuda.h" |
| |
| namespace xla { |
| namespace gpu { |
| |
| // TODO(b/30467474) Once GPU infeed implementation settles, consider |
| // folding back the cpu and gpu infeed implementations into a generic |
| // one if possible. |
| // |
| // Current limitations: |
| // * Does not handle multiple devices/replicas. |
| // |
| // * Buffer space on GPU is allocated on every infeed enqueue request, |
| // and it does not handle the case when it runs out of |
| // memory. Potential solution is to pre-allocate a fixed amount of |
| // memory and block when that memory is full. |
| |
| // Client-side class used to enqueue infeed buffers. |
| class InfeedManager |
| : public XfeedQueue<ShapeTree<se::ScopedDeviceMemory<uint8>>> { |
| public: |
| explicit InfeedManager(se::StreamExecutor* executor); |
| |
| Status TransferLiteralToInfeed(se::StreamExecutor* executor, |
| const LiteralSlice& literal); |
| |
| private: |
| se::Stream* stream() const { return stream_.get(); } |
| |
| // Stream used to enqueue infeed device copies. |
| std::unique_ptr<se::Stream> stream_; |
| }; |
| |
| // Returns the GPU infeed manager for the given stream executor, |
| InfeedManager* GetOrCreateInfeedManager(se::StreamExecutor* executor); |
| |
| } // namespace gpu |
| } // namespace xla |
